2. | John Alford Stiles was born in 1838 in Lynchburg,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States (son of James Stiles and Mary Ann Taylor); died in 1912 in _______, _______, Tennessee, United States; was buried in 1912 in Pleasant Hill Cemetery, Vanntown,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States. Notes: There are multiple burial references for John Alford Stiles. One has him buried at Pleasant View Cemetery, Fayetteville, Lincoln County, Tennessee. However there is no first hand evidence of a grave site or marker. More likely, John Alford Stiles is buried at Pleasant Hill Cemetery near Vanntown, Lincoln County, Tennessee, located on the site of Pleasant Hill Baptist Church. Pleasant Hill Cemetery is where his second wife Sarah Catherine McDaniel is buried, and John Alford Stiles was married to Sarah for almost 35 years. John married Mariah Payne on 2 Feb 1860 in Fayetteville,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States. Mariah was born on 14 Aug 1835 in _______, _______, Tennessee, United States; died about 1865 in _______,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States. [Group Sheet] [Family Chart] |

4. | James Stiles was born in 1809 in _______, Laurens District, South Carolina, United States (son of John Stiles and Margaret Lynch); died in 1875 in _______,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States; was buried in 1875 in Stiles Cemetery, near Kelso,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States. Notes: [LDS-AF-2002a] lists death at Cedar Bluff, Tennessee (with burial at Cedar Bluff Cemetery) but this conflicts with [Stiles-Cemetery-1875a] which convincingly places burial at Stiles Cemetery in Lincoln County, Tennessee. James married Mary Ann Taylor in 1826 in Taylorville,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States. Mary was born on 15 Nov 1811 in Edgecombe, Pender County, North Carolina, United States; died on 26 Dec 1897 in _______,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States; was buried after 26 Dec 1897 in Stiles Cemetery, near Kelso,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States. 8. | John Stiles was born in 1780 in Laurens, Ninety-Six District, South Carolina, United States (son of Richard Stiles, Sr. and Frances Coussens); died on 3 Nov 1825 in _______,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States; was buried in Nov 1825 in Cemetery No. 1, Huntland, Franklin County, Tennessee, United States. Notes: The first 9 children of John Stiles and Margaret Lynch (Aaron, John R, John (?), Francis Seaborn, James, William Jesse, Margaret, and Jane) were all born in Laurens (Laurens County, South Carolina). Sometime between the birth of Jane in 1816 and the birth of Samuel in 1821 the family moved to Lincoln County, Tennessee. John married Margaret Lynch in 1800 in _______, Warren County, North Carolina, United States. Margaret (daughter of Aaron Lynch and Polly Lynch) was born before 1790 in Huntland, Franklin County, Tennessee Territory; died in 1838 in _______, Lincoln County, Tennessee, United States; was buried in 1839 in Cemetery No. 1, Huntland, Franklin County, Tennessee, United States.
